How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Haverhill?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Haverhill Studio Apartments | $1,802 | $1,250 | $2,635 |
Haverhill 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,437 | $1,200 | $3,725 |
Haverhill 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,191 | $1,765 | $4,660 |
Haverhill 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,614 | $2,300 | $3,100 |
Haverhill 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,733 | $2,500 | $2,900 |

Haverhill Overview
The city of Haverhill, MA is one of the jewels of the Northeast. It sits near Boston, on the border of New Hampshire, and is only a few miles from the Atlantic Ocean. Many people are looking to live in apartments in Haverhill, MA because of the job opportunities and the laid back coastal atmosphere that seems to permeate everything that happens in this charming town. Anyone who is looking for Haverhill apartments should take a few minutes to learn a little bit more about this beautiful city.
Why live in Haverhill, MA?
There are a few reasons why so many people love to live in Haverhill, MA. First, it is close to Boston, which means that people can live in Haverhill, MA, and avoid paying Boston prices while still enjoying the hustle and bustle of Boston. Second, Haverhill, MA is close to the coast, which is great for anyone who loves to spend time on the water. Finally, Haverhill, MA is also known for its delicious food, including Boston clam chowder!
